Key Responsibilities
  • To provide support to the examinations process & support the Examinations Manager with the day-to-day operation of examination venues.
  • Assisting with setting-up examination venues including laying out stationery, equipment and examination papers or computer set up in accordance with strict procedures
  • Assisting candidates prior to the start of examinations by directing them to their seats and advising them about possessions permitted in examination venues
  • Ensuring that candidates do not talk once inside examination venues
  • Invigilating during examinations, dealing with queries raised by candidates, ensuring malpractice does not occur and dealing with examination irregularities in accordance with strict procedures
